Jim Simons is the founder of Renaissance Technologies, one of the most successful quantitative hedge funds in the world. Before his career in finance, he served as a mathematics professor and made significant contributions to differential geometry. Simons applied his analytical expertise to develop sophisticated, algorithm-driven trading strategies, earning consistently high returns for investors.

Jim Simons's Q3 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2020, Jim Simons held 3,879 positions worth $100B, down 14% from $116B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Jim Simons withdrew a net $21.7B in Q3 2020, closing 544 positions and reducing 1,671 holdings. Its most notable exit was Alibaba, an estimated $426M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 23%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Staples.

Against the trend, Jim Simons opened a new position in Microsoft worth $277M.

  • Jim Simons's largest Q3 2020 buy was Microsoft: 1,315,812 shares worth $277M.
  • Jim Simons added most to Procter & Gamble in Q3 2020, an estimated $243M increase.
  • Jim Simons's biggest Q3 2020 reduction was Tesla, cutting an estimated $1.95B.
  • Jim Simons fully exited Alibaba in Q3 2020, selling an estimated $426M.
  • Jim Simons's ten largest holdings make up 15% of its $100B portfolio in Q3 2020.
  • Jim Simons opened 490 new positions and closed 544 in Q3 2020.
  • Jim Simons's portfolio value fell 14% quarter-over-quarter to $100B.

Based on Renaissance Technologies's 13F filing for Q3 2020, filed 13 Nov 2020.
